Abstract

The invention relates to a method for treating an elongated object using a plasma process. The method comprises the steps of providing an elongated object in a planar electrode structure, and applying potential differences between electrodes of an electrode structure to generate the plasma process. Further, the method comprises at least partially surrounding the elongated object by a unitary section of the guiding structure, the electrode structure being associated with the unitary section.

Claims (29)

1. An elongated object comprising polyethylene yarn which is free of spin finish which has been treated by a process for generating a plasma comprising the steps of:

(i) applying potential differences between electrodes of an electrode structure to generate the plasma,

(ii) at least partially cross-sectionally surrounding the elongated object by a guiding structure which includes a curved unitary section that is cross-sectionally concave, the electrode structure being associated with the curved unitary section, wherein

the electrode structure comprises a dielectric body provided with a curved section integrated with the curved unitary section, and at least one electrode arranged at the radial inner side of the dielectric body section or embedded in the dielectric body, and wherein

the elongated objected treated by the plasma exhibits an increased adhesion of the polyethylene yarn to a polymeric bonding matrix as compared to an identical spin finish free polyethylene yarn not treated by the plasma.

2. An elongated object comprising a polyethylene yarn which is free of spin finish, the elongated object having increased surface energy and adhesion bonding to a polymeric bonding matrix by treatment with a plasma generated by a plasma-generating apparatus, the apparatus comprising:

(i) a guiding structure for guiding the elongated object, and

(ii) an electrode structure for generating the plasma, wherein

the guiding structure comprises an elongated object receiving curved unitary section that is cross-sectionally concave and arranged for at least partially cross-sectionally surrounding the elongated object, and wherein

the electrode structure is associated with the curved unitary section, and wherein

the electrode structure comprises a dielectric body provided with a curved section integrated with the curved unitary section, and at least one electrode arranged at the radial inner side of the dielectric body section or embedded in the dielectric body, and wherein

the electrode structure applies a potential difference between the at least one electrode arranged at the radial inner side of the dielectric body section or embedded in the dielectric body and at least one other electrode of the electrode structure to generate the plasma and thereby obtain the elongated object having increased surface energy and adhesion bonding to the polymeric bonding matrix.

3. An elongate object comprising polyethylene yarn which is free of spin finish and which has been treated by a plasma generated between electrodes of a planar electrode structure so as to exhibit an increased surface energy and thereby an increase adhesion of the polyethylene yarn to a polymeric bonding matrix as compared to an identical spin finish free polyethylene yarn not treated by the plasma.

4. The elongate object according to claim 3 , wherein the polyethylene yarn comprises a disordered system of polyethylene filaments.

5. The elongate object according to claim 3 , wherein the polyethylene yarn is a felt.

6. The elongate object according to claim 3 , wherein the polyethylene yarn comprises an ordered system of polyethylene filaments.

7. The elongate object according to claim 3 , wherein the polyethylene yarn comprises high tenacity polyethylene filaments.

8. A composite article which comprises a polymeric bonding matrix and the elongate object according to claim 3 embedded in the polymeric bonding matrix.

9. The composite article according to claim 8 , wherein the polymeric bonding matrix comprises a polyurethane.

10. The composite article according to claim 8 , wherein the polyethylene yarn exhibits a surface energy in a range of 84-90 mJ/m 2 after the plasma treatment.

11. An elongate object having increased surface energy and adhesion bonding to a polymeric bonding matrix which is made by a process comprising:

(i) providing at least one elongated object in the form of a spin finish free polyethylene yarn and a planar electrode structure, and

(ii) positioning the elongated object near and/or on the electrode structure and applying potential differences between electrodes of the electrode structure to generate a plasma and thereby obtain the elongate object having increased surface energy and adhesion bonding to the polymeric bonding matrix.

12. The elongate object according to claim 11 , wherein the elongated object is guided between a pair of planar electrode structures arranged opposite with respect to each other.

13. A product which comprises a plurality of the elongate objects according to claim 11 .

14. The product according to claim 13 , wherein the elongate objects comprise an ordered system.

15. The product according to claim 14 , wherein the ordered system of elongate objects comprises a unidirectional fabric.

16. The product according to claim 13 , wherein the elongate objects comprise a disordered system.

17. The product according to claim 16 , wherein the disordered system of elongate objects comprises a felt.
